PM Modi hosts high tea for NDA MPs
New Delhi, Oct 26 (IBNS) It was for the first time since the BJP led-government assumed office that Prime Minister Narendra Modi hosted a high tea for all National Democratic Alliance (NDA) MPs at his residence in New Delhi on Sunday.
NDA MPs attended the event.
Modi had also invited all the allies of BJP including its estranged partner Shiv Sena MPs despite their break up ahead of the Maharashtra Assembly elections.
According to reports, senior BJP leaders like LK Advani, party presdient Amit Shah and Union Ministers attended the meeting.
